WebUnknown: Perk Brown, whose real name was Jack Thomasson, ran NASCAR Modifieds primarily during his career, and at one point, won six of the seven NASCAR Modified events held at the Martinsville (VA) Speedway from 1962 through 1965. Brown is also ranks sixth in career Modified wins at the famed Bowman-Gray Stadium in Winston-Salem, NC. podcast jon malliaWebPerk Brown with his self-owned NASCAR Modified at Martinsville Speedway.
